Zebra Talk

Zebra Talk is a wonderful, patient-friendly guide on the world of neuroendocrine cancer. Featuring information and tips on navigating this disease from diagnoses to treatments. Below is a note from the editor, Suzi Garber. “This booklet is intended as a reference for those newly diagnosed with NETs, in the process, or hoping to explore this bewildering world. It is also a guide to resources that can empower patients through knowledge

Wren Labs to Visit Northwoods NETS

Nancy Teixeira, who is a Carcinoid cancer patient, registered nurse and the Administrator/Nurse Clinician for Wren Laboratories, LLC will be presenting to Northwoods NETS on May 18th at Fairview Ridges Hospital in Burnsville, MN. She will begin her talk at 2pm, one hour before our normal support group meeting. Nancy has been living with the diease for over 18 years.
